Discover the perfect summer listen from the bestselling author of We All Want Impossible Things.

One week at golden Cape Cod. The perfect family holiday. What could possibly go wrong?

For the past two decades, Rocky has looked forward to her family’s yearly escape to the beach.

The humble, quirky house they rent has been the site of sweet memories, sunny days, shared mishaps and memories. It is a place where her family comes together and Rocky wants to cling to every moment.

Now, sandwiched between her children who are adult enough to be fun but still young enough to need her, and her parents who are ageing but healthy enough, Rocky wants to preserve this precious moment for ever.

But with her body in open revolt and surprises invading her peaceful haven, the seesaw of Rocky’s life is tipping towards change…
